Home
last modified time | relevance | path

Searched refs:app_ctx (Results 1 - 18 of 18) sorted by relevance

/kernel/linux/linux-5.10/drivers/net/ethernet/cavium/liquidio/
H A Docteon_droq.h317 void *app_ctx; member
334 * @param app_ctx - pointer to application context
341 void *app_ctx);
403 u32 num_descs, u32 desc_size, void *app_ctx);
H A Docteon_iq.h170 void *app_ctx; member
395 void *app_ctx);
H A Docteon_droq.c224 void *app_ctx) in octeon_init_droq()
238 if (app_ctx) in octeon_init_droq()
239 droq->app_ctx = app_ctx; in octeon_init_droq()
241 droq->app_ctx = (void *)(size_t)q_no; in octeon_init_droq()
927 u32 desc_size, void *app_ctx) in octeon_create_droq()
952 if (octeon_init_droq(oct, q_no, num_descs, desc_size, app_ctx)) { in octeon_create_droq()
220 octeon_init_droq(struct octeon_device *oct, u32 q_no, u32 num_descs, u32 desc_size, void *app_ctx) octeon_init_droq() argument
925 octeon_create_droq(struct octeon_device *oct, u32 q_no, u32 num_descs, u32 desc_size, void *app_ctx) octeon_create_droq() argument
H A Drequest_manager.c204 void *app_ctx) in octeon_setup_iq()
213 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
226 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
432 octeon_report_tx_completion_to_bql(iq->app_ctx, pkts_compl, in lio_process_iq_request_list()
199 octeon_setup_iq(struct octeon_device *oct, int ifidx, int q_index, union oct_txpciq txpciq, u32 num_descs, void *app_ctx) octeon_setup_iq() argument
H A Docteon_device.h543 void *app_ctx; member
H A Dlio_core.c531 * @app_ctx: application context
534 int desc_size, void *app_ctx) in octeon_setup_droq()
540 ret_val = octeon_create_droq(oct, q_no, num_descs, desc_size, app_ctx); in octeon_setup_droq()
533 octeon_setup_droq(struct octeon_device *oct, int q_no, int num_descs, int desc_size, void *app_ctx) octeon_setup_droq() argument
H A Docteon_device.c891 oct->instr_queue[0]->app_ctx = (void *)(size_t)0; in octeon_setup_instr_queues()
/kernel/linux/linux-6.6/drivers/net/ethernet/cavium/liquidio/
H A Docteon_droq.h317 void *app_ctx; member
334 * @param app_ctx - pointer to application context
341 void *app_ctx);
403 u32 num_descs, u32 desc_size, void *app_ctx);
H A Docteon_iq.h170 void *app_ctx; member
395 void *app_ctx);
H A Docteon_droq.c226 void *app_ctx) in octeon_init_droq()
240 if (app_ctx) in octeon_init_droq()
241 droq->app_ctx = app_ctx; in octeon_init_droq()
243 droq->app_ctx = (void *)(size_t)q_no; in octeon_init_droq()
931 u32 desc_size, void *app_ctx) in octeon_create_droq()
956 if (octeon_init_droq(oct, q_no, num_descs, desc_size, app_ctx)) { in octeon_create_droq()
222 octeon_init_droq(struct octeon_device *oct, u32 q_no, u32 num_descs, u32 desc_size, void *app_ctx) octeon_init_droq() argument
929 octeon_create_droq(struct octeon_device *oct, u32 q_no, u32 num_descs, u32 desc_size, void *app_ctx) octeon_create_droq() argument
H A Drequest_manager.c196 void *app_ctx) in octeon_setup_iq()
205 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
218 oct->instr_queue[iq_no]->app_ctx = app_ctx; in octeon_setup_iq()
427 octeon_report_tx_completion_to_bql(iq->app_ctx, pkts_compl, in lio_process_iq_request_list()
191 octeon_setup_iq(struct octeon_device *oct, int ifidx, int q_index, union oct_txpciq txpciq, u32 num_descs, void *app_ctx) octeon_setup_iq() argument
H A Docteon_device.h543 void *app_ctx; member
H A Dlio_core.c539 * @app_ctx: application context
542 int desc_size, void *app_ctx) in octeon_setup_droq()
548 ret_val = octeon_create_droq(oct, q_no, num_descs, desc_size, app_ctx); in octeon_setup_droq()
541 octeon_setup_droq(struct octeon_device *oct, int q_no, int num_descs, int desc_size, void *app_ctx) octeon_setup_droq() argument
H A Docteon_device.c898 oct->instr_queue[0]->app_ctx = (void *)(size_t)0; in octeon_setup_instr_queues()
/kernel/linux/linux-5.10/drivers/crypto/caam/
H A Dqi.h78 * @app_ctx: arbitrary context attached with request by the application
90 void *app_ctx; member
H A Dcaamalg_qi.c916 struct aead_request *aead_req = drv_req->app_ctx; in aead_done()
1090 edesc->drv_req.app_ctx = req; in aead_edesc_alloc()
1208 struct skcipher_request *req = drv_req->app_ctx; in skcipher_done()
1356 edesc->drv_req.app_ctx = req; in skcipher_edesc_alloc()
/kernel/linux/linux-6.6/drivers/crypto/caam/
H A Dqi.h82 * @app_ctx: arbitrary context attached with request by the application
94 void *app_ctx; member
H A Dcaamalg_qi.c921 struct aead_request *aead_req = drv_req->app_ctx; in aead_done()
1095 edesc->drv_req.app_ctx = req; in aead_edesc_alloc()
1219 struct skcipher_request *req = drv_req->app_ctx; in skcipher_done()
1356 edesc->drv_req.app_ctx = req; in skcipher_edesc_alloc()

Completed in 25 milliseconds